Read 2 Timothy 1:3-14.


Paul reminds Timothy of his heritage in the faith and to be strong in continuing that heritage; to pass along to others what has been given to him. Timothy was in a time of transition. He had been Paul’s helper, and soon he would be on his own as a leader of a church in a difficult environment. Although things were changing, Timothy was not without help. He had everything he needed to face the future if he would hold on to the LORD’s resources. Paul encouraged Timothy with words of hope and encouragement. Paul spoke of finding comfort and strength in God’s grace through Jesus.


When you are facing difficult situations or transitions look back at your experiences. Who is the foundation of your faith? How can you build on that foundation? What gifts has the Holy Spirit given you? How do you share your faith with others?
